What is symmetry in inorganic chemistry?

A symmetry element is a geometrical entity about which a symmetry operation is performed. A symmetry element can be a point, axis, or plane. A symmetry operation is the movement of a body (molecule) such that after the movement the molecule appears the same as before.

What are the four types of symmetry operations?

There are five types of symmetry operations including identity, reflection, inversion, proper rotation, and improper rotation.

Which is a member of the T D point group?

The T d Point Group The tetrahedron, as well as tetrahedral molecules and anions such as CH 4 and BF 4 – belong to the high symmetry point group T d. Let us find the symmetry elements and symmetry operations that belong to the point group T d. First, we should not forget the identity operation, E.
